Dedicated Dressage Court and Grass Jumper Ring

February 06, 2010

With the arrival of a respected dressage trainer, Petra Beltran, we have decided to invest further into Clermont Equestrian so that we have the best dressage court at a boarding facility in the San Francisco Peninsula. To achieve this, we will be extending the length of the ring so that riders can canter in and circumnavigate the entire court prior to beginning their test. Secondly, after listening to several dressage riders and trainers, we decided to mirror the entire short side. The company doing this work will be the contractor that installed the mirrors at Stanford. Doing the short side seems to be the most important position to put them first. Later there may be more mirrors, but for now this is the first phase in our quest to be the undisputed best boarding and training facility for both dressage and jumper riders. For jumpers, the Grand Prix grass ring located in the Southeastern corner of Clermont will be completed mid summer.
